Spotify Greenroom Spotify Launches Its Own Clubhouse Like Audio Chat App

Just three months after announcing the acquisition of Locker Room, the music streaming company is launching what it calls ‘Spotify Greenroom‘. Spotify Greenroom is a live audio chat platform – similar to Clubhouse – that allows users worldwide to join or host live audio chat rooms. And takes it one step further with the option to turn their Greenroom conversations into podcasts. According to information on Techcrunch, the Spotify Greenroom app is based on Locker Room’s existing code, and the current users of Locker Room will see their app update to become the rebranded and redesigned Greenroom experience (a switch from Lockroom’s white and reddish-orange color scheme to the new Greenroom app’s green and black design) Spotify says its current users on Spotify can sign into Greenroom with their current Spotify account information....

This Is Mirembe Chat Bot Uganda S First Artificially Intelligent Health Adviser

Mirembe chat bot is the first of its kind in Uganda and the entire African continent. Made by The Medical Concierge Group (TMCG), the new chat bot is custom-made as a female personal health adviser named “Mirembe”. ‘Mirembe’ directly translates to “Peace” in Luganda, a widely used language in the Central area of Uganda. It offers free triage and care advice to health symptoms in Facebook Messenger. In 2017, Facebook challenged developers in Africa to create innovative bots in the Bots for Messenger Developer Challenge....

Understanding The Wps Button On Your Router Mifi

WPS button. What does it do? WPS stands for Wi-Fi Protected Setup. The WPS protocol is a popular network security standard used to create a secure wireless home network. The WPS button simplifies the process of connecting to a network without the hustle of typing complicated passwords (WPA/WPA2 encryption key). You can use the WPS button to connect a laptop, wireless printer, smartphone, wireless extender, e.t.c to your network. Once a connection has been made, WPS will turn itself off....
